Understanding Windows Mobile 5.0
This chapter introduces Microsoft Windows Mobile 5.0. While using the
computer, keep these key points in mind:
•Tap Start on the navigation bar, located at the top of the screen, to
quickly move to programs, files, and settings. Use the command bar at
the bottom of the screen to perform tasks in programs. The command
bar includes menus, icons, and the onscreen keyboard.
Tap and hold an item to see a pop-up menu containing a list of actions
you can perform. Pop-up menus give you quick and easy access to the
most common actions.
•Tap Start > Help, and then select a topic on your computer to find
additional information on Windows Mobile components.
